CAT724_rsyslogで起動が一時停止する件

起動時に

Starting enhanced syslogd: rsyslogd

の行で起動が30秒ほど止まってしまう件。

原因は自分のホスト名(この場合は supercat)をDNSサーバに問い合わせに行き、タイムアウトまで待っている場合に発生する。

対策として自分のホスト名(supercat)の名前解決が出来ればよい。

  • /etc/hosts
127.0.0.1       localhost supercat
# ping supercat
PING localhost (127.0.0.1) 56(84) bytes of data.
64 bytes from localhost (127.0.0.1): icmp_req=1 ttl=64 time=0.000 ms
64 bytes from localhost (127.0.0.1): icmp_req=2 ttl=64 time=0.000 ms

のように supercat が 127.0.0.1 と解決できるようになればok

関連